Ceres, July 5, 2025 -

A traffic collision on State Route 99 North in Ceres, CA, has caused significant disruptions to traffic flow today. The incident occurred around 3:07 PM and involved two vehicles: a white van and an unknown-color SUV. The collision resulted in damage to the white van, which required a tow truck to the scene.

Emergency response units arrived quickly to manage the situation, leading to lane closures along State Route 99 North at Whitmore Avenue. As a result, motorists experienced delays and congestion in the area, particularly during the busy afternoon traffic hours.

Traffic management personnel worked diligently to secure the collision scene and facilitate the safe movement of vehicles. The presence of emergency responders contributed to slower traffic as they directed drivers away from the affected lanes.
